💼 Luxury Liquid Silicone Case (for Samsung Galaxy Series)
I was drawn to this luxury silicone case for its minimalist look and the promise of a premium “soft-touch” finish. The product photos made it look like something Apple would release, but for a fraction of the price. I picked it for my Galaxy S23 and hoped it would add grip without bulk.
Once it arrived (in just under two weeks to the US), I was genuinely impressed. The packaging was basic but protective. The silicone material feels velvety and smooth—super comfortable to hold. The fit is perfect, hugging every curve of my phone snugly without interfering with buttons or ports.
Pros: – Excellent fit and tactile button feedback – Rich, vibrant color (I chose navy blue) – Matte texture resists fingerprints – Doesn’t attract lint as much as cheaper silicone cases
Cons: – No screen protection (no raised lip) – Dust sneaks in near the camera module if you don’t clean regularly
Compared to similar silicone cases on Amazon ($15–$25), this one was under $5 and genuinely feels more high-end. It exceeded my expectations and gave me confidence to try other AliExpress cases.

🛡️ 1.5MM Air-Bag Clear Case
This one’s all about drop protection without hiding the phone’s look. I chose it for my Galaxy A53 as a practical everyday case. What got my attention was the reinforced air-bag corners, claiming military-grade protection.
It arrived in around 11 days. The case is crystal clear with slightly thickened corners, giving me peace of mind when I’m out and about. Installation was quick and satisfying with that nice clicky snap.
Pros: – Transparent and shows off the phone – Air-cushion corners actually add real shock absorption – Doesn’t yellow quickly (still clear after 3 weeks)
Cons: – Adds some bulk – The edges are a bit stiff, making removal tricky
At just $3, it offers better protection than a $20 Spigen clear case I previously owned. Not bad at all.

💪 Shockproof Armor Case (Rugged Design)
I grabbed this shockproof case for my work phone (A14) where drops are a weekly event. The rugged corners and thick shell stood out immediately. Plus, the design had a nice urban/military vibe.
In hand, it feels solid. The texture gives a good grip and the raised edges around the screen and camera offer solid protection. After a minor drop from my desk, the phone stayed intact with zero scuffs.
Pros: – Super protective build – Grippy texture – Camera and screen protection
Cons: – Bulky in pockets – Attracts dust in the ridges
For $4.80, this performs on par with a $30 OtterBox. Solid value.
